Me and my company object to significant price increases for obtaining
new and/or renewing domain names from registrars.
Many of our clients start with very little capital and startups are
already financially risky. It does not help matters to add extra costs
to new and growing companies.
Social media sites seem to have taken majority of the traffic and
there's already less visitors to small business sites. These small
businesses have to invest more money already, competing with the bigger
companies while search engines are making constant changes and
requirements to how the web should be, thus requiring more investment in
developers.
Further taxes/fees on domain ownership is not a good strategy for
enterprising the world wide web for the masses of business owners and
even smaller individuals with their personal portals, paying out of
pocket, with no intent on financial gains.
